Ingredients You’ll Need

Essential ingredients for the base recipe

To make this Grilled Cheese Roll Ups Recipe, grab 8 slices of soft white bread with crusts removed, 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ese, and 6 tablespoons butter. Fresh bread works best since it rolls easily. Also, shredded cheese melts faster and helps hold everything together.

How to Make Grilled Cheese Roll Ups (Step-by-Step)

Prepare and flatten the bread

First, remove the crusts from each slice of bread. Then, flatten each piece with a rolling pin until thin and flexible. This step helps prevent tearing.

Add cheese and roll tightly

Next, sprinkle shredded cheese evenly over each slice. After that, roll the bread tightly into a log shape so it stays compact during cooking.

Melt butter and coat each roll

Meanwhile, melt butter in a skillet over medium heat. Then, lightly dip each roll into the melted butter so all sides get coated.

Cook until golden and crispy

Place the rolls in the skillet and cook them while turning often. Within 1 to 2 minutes per side, they become golden brown and crispy.

Serve warm with your favorite dips

Finally, remove from the pan and serve immediately. Pair with your favorite dipping sauces for the best experience.

Pro Tips for Perfect Results Every Time

Choose the right bread texture

Soft, fresh bread works best. It rolls easily and helps create smooth, tight roll ups without cracking.

Why finely shredded cheese works best

Finely shredded cheese melts faster and spreads evenly. As a result, it creates that perfect gooey center.

How to keep roll ups from unrolling

Roll tightly and place seam-side down first in the pan. Then, let it cook briefly so it seals before turning.

Getting that even golden crisp

Turn the roll ups often while cooking. This helps all sides brown evenly and keeps them from burning.

Easy Variations to Try

Add protein like ham or turkey

Add thin slices of ham or turkey before rolling. This makes the roll ups more filling and adds extra flavor.

Try different cheeses for new flavors

Swap cheddar for mozzarella, Swiss, or pepper jack. Each option gives a new taste and texture.

Make it spicy or veggie-packed

Add chili flakes or diced jalapeños for heat. You can also include spinach or mushrooms for a veggie boost.

Use whole wheat or flavored bread

Whole wheat bread adds a slightly nutty taste. Meanwhile, garlic bread adds extra flavor to every bite.

Storage and Reheating Tips

How to store leftovers properly

Place leftovers in an airtight container and store them in the fridge. They stay fresh for a few days.

Best methods to reheat and keep crisp

Reheat in a skillet or oven for the best texture. However, the microwave works if you need something quick.

Can you freeze grilled cheese roll ups?

Yes, you can freeze them after cooking. Then, reheat in the oven until hot and crispy again.
